Generic Single Board Computer Vintage PCB

The Generic Single Board Computer stands out as a robust and versatile solution designed to meet the demanding requirements of the power industry, petrochemical sector, and general automation applications. Engineered with precision, this SBC offers a compelling blend of high-performance computing, extensive input/output capacity, and exceptional durability, making it an ideal choice for mission-critical environments. At the core of the Generic Single Board Computer is a powerful processing unit capable of handling complex automation tasks with efficiency and reliability. It supports a wide range of input/output interfaces, including digital and analog channels, serial communication ports such as RS-232 and RS-485, and Ethernet connectivity. This comprehensive I/O configuration ensures seamless integration with sensors, actuators, and control systems commonly found in industrial automation setups. The board’s rugged design features industrial-grade components that withstand extreme temperatures, humidity, and vibration, ensuring uninterrupted operation even in harsh petrochemical plants or power distribution stations. Performance-wise, the Generic Single Board Computer excels with low latency processing and real-time data handling capabilities. Its architecture supports fast data acquisition, processing, and communication, essential for automation systems that require immediate response to dynamic operational changes. 


The system is equipped with onboard memory and storage options optimized for embedded applications, allowing it to run complex control algorithms and maintain critical logs without external dependencies. Moreover, its energy-efficient design supports continuous operation under power-constrained conditions, a key factor in remote or distributed automation installations. In real-world scenarios, the Generic Single Board Computer proves indispensable across various sectors. In the power industry, it facilitates advanced grid management, real-time monitoring of transformers, and substation automation, enabling utility providers to enhance reliability and reduce downtime. Within petrochemical plants, its robust I/O capabilities support hazardous environment monitoring, process control, and safety interlocks, ensuring compliance with stringent industrial standards. For general automation, it integrates seamlessly into manufacturing lines, robotics, and building management systems, delivering precise control and data analytics to optimize productivity and maintenance schedules.
